An amazing and superb, cuboctahedral Magnetite measuring 2.3 cm across sits partly embedded in a matrix of micro-crystalline buttermilk Asbestos of the variety Mountain Leather. This is an excellent example and so characteristic of specimens from Totenkopf, by the Lower Riffl glacier in the Stubach valley in Austria. The Magnetite crystal is lead-grey with a finely-speckled texture and dull, slightly silky lustre and exhibits sharp edges and perfectly developed faces. The lower half of this crystal is embedded in the matrix and a smaller Magnetite crystal is attached to one side of the larger. The Mountain Leather is composed of layered fibres and platelets forming gently curved foliated mounds and crevices with the appearance of clotted cream.
